Backend Engineer

SeaSingaporePosted 19 May 2026

Sea is hiring a Backend Engineer to join their team focused on enterprise products and workplace solutions. The role involves full-stack software development, including design, implementation, testing, and cloud infrastructure deployment. Candidates are expected to have a solid foundation in computer science and proficiency in Go or Python. The position emphasizes writing testable, maintainable code for large-scale distributed systems.

Must haves

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field
  • Strong understanding of computer science fundamentals
  • Relevant backend experience using Go or Python
  • Familiarity with OOP and RESTful API design
  • Experience with Linux, Docker, and Nginx
